Transaction 85e792fd18b30e617140fe84e8d3a48143b577a762cd2eaa58867856b7a63b08

2 Input
2 Outputs
  • 85e792fd18b30e617140fe84e8d3a48143b577a762cd2eaa58867856b7a63b08:0
  • value  237155
    address  1Pjhf6si4HcgfztWyuqnNzLJESWqhhfjtg
  • 85e792fd18b30e617140fe84e8d3a48143b577a762cd2eaa58867856b7a63b08:1
  • value  387303
    address  3NfHcKT8TjarSzbK4QdhNce1EVEJBUsaSo